As fans I think we want as bigger stadium as we can get but realistically 40k is probably the sensible and right choice. 

 

Yes, there's the odd game like the Everton or Athletico Madrid game where demand is going to go through the roof but I'd imagine a mediocre Premier League game is not going to get anywhere near full capacity. 

 

We're never going to attract tourists like some other clubs (which is probably a good thing) and although we are ran brilliantly, we're only one average season away from the average attendance dropping by 5k I'd imagine. 

 

We can always expand again if needed so it's not like it's locked in for good either.
